Duta Kiara & D'Kiara Place
YNH Property Bhd plans to launch Duta Kiara & D'Kiara Place late this year and early next year.
Duta Kiara 163 suites consist of 110 units of luxurious condominium with built-up area of at least 3800 square feet and is priced at about RM3 million. That would be approximately RM789-00 per square feet.
D'Kiara place is located next to existing Mont Kiara Plaza and is a mixed development consisting of retail units, service apartments & office block.

Debt is good
Debt is good, how can that be, but debt is really good especially if it is going to be paid back by others.
Debt is good when it is being used to invest in asset that can appreciate and at the same time generating rental income to the investor.
Lets investigate in an example, assuming that an investor purchase a 1400 square feet condo in Mont Kiara from a developer during an initial launch at RM400-00 per square feet and assuming that he take 90% loan from a bank.
Cost of condo = 1400 x RM400-00 = RM560,000-00
Down payment = RM56,000-00 (10%)
Monthly repayment for loan at interest rate of 5.99% for repayment period of 30 years = RM3,018-50
Interest rate of 5.99% is derived from a post of our property forum
Monthly installment of RM3,018-50 can be calculated using our loan calculator
Monthly rental = 1400 x RM3-00 = RM4,200-00
Monthly maintenance charges = RM0-27 x 1400 = RM378-00
Net monthly rental = RM4,200-00 - RM378-00 = RM3,822-00
Return per month = RM3,822-00 - RM3,018-50 = RM803-50
Return per year = RM803-50 x 12 = RM9,462-00
Amount of equity invested = RM56,000-00
Amount of return per year = RM9,462-00
That works out to be = 9,642-00 x 100 / 56,000-00 = 17.2%
Of course there are still some minor charges that have been taken into account such as assessment, quit rent etc but the gross return based on small equity of RM56,000-00 together with leveraging effect of using a bank loan to finance the purchase when planned carefully can bring meaningful return.
On top of that, the purchaser is bound to reap the capital gain over time when the property appreciate, healthy rental income enable the owner to hold the property longer to enjoy capital appreciation

Legal fees on transfer
When one is buying a landed property from developer before commencement of construction work or during construction stage, it is wise to confirm with the developer whether the status of the land on which the building is going to be constructed is still under a master title of the entire development or is it under a individual title. If the land is still under a master title, then what is normally done during the sale and purchase agreement stage is that there is an assignment of a portion of the master title to the purchaser in relation to the landed property that he or she has purchased. Only upon the completion of subdivision and when the individual title is issued can the transfer be executed to complete the transfer of the property to the purchaser.
In essence, if the land is still under a master title, there will be two legal process which mean two legal fees involved. One for the assignment during the sale and purchase agreement stage and another for the eventual transfer. Therefore if the land come with individual title, there will be only one process where the purchaser will save on legal fees.
In most cases where developer rush to develope their land soon after the purchase of land, the status would most likely still be under a master title, why not negotiate with the developer to absorb the legal fees for the sale and purchase agreement so that eventually one would only need to pay the legal fees for transfer when the individual title is issued after the completion of land subdivision

Property sector get another boost with budget 2008
1. EPF contributors can make monthly withdrawal from account II to settle housing loan.
2. 50% reduction in stamp duty for those buying a property not exceeding RM250,000-00
3. The government has allocated a fund to provide guarantees to the banks to help those in the low income group to obtain housing loan.

Grace period or interest free period
After one is satisfied with the selection of the property he is intending to purchase, signing of the sale and purchase agreement is the next obvious step. If the property that one intend to purchase is already in the advance stage of construction, always remember to negotiate for an interest free period or grace period to allow yourself time to source for a loan as the time taken for
1. selection of loan
2. loan documentation
until the fund is released by the financier bank can be quite long. Therefore it is advisable to negotiate for a minimum of 60 days or 90 days. The interest free period is particularly important if the construction of the property is already in advance stage and if the buyer is taking maximum loan of 90% as one can expect that upon signing of sale & purchase agreement, the developer will flood the buyer with a series of progress billing that will be due 21 working days after issuance of billing that make it to about a month including the non-working days and the late payment interest is normally 10% which is higher than the loan interest rate which can be as low as zero for the first year for some loan package from certain bank. Without the interest free period, the buyer would most likely be charged hefty late payment charges as the amount of billing can be as high as 75% of purchase price which the interest calculation is based on.
However if one is buying a property where construction has yet to begin, then the issue of interest free period may not be critical but as buying a property is not something that one do very often, why not exercise your right to as much as possible before you sign above the dotted line.
